Windows: Run library restore ina separate process as on some windows machines, running it in the main process causes something in the system to lock the db file.

def windows_repair(library_path=None):
from binascii import hexlify, unhexlify
import cPickle, subprocess
if library_path:
library_path = hexlify(cPickle.dumps(library_path, -1))
winutil.prepare_for_restart()
os.environ['CALIBRE_REPAIR_CORRUPTED_DB'] = library_path
subprocess.Popen([sys.executable])
else:
try:
app = Application([])
from calibre.gui2.dialogs.restore_library import repair_library_at
library_path = cPickle.loads(unhexlify(os.environ.pop('CALIBRE_REPAIR_CORRUPTED_DB')))
done = repair_library_at(library_path, wait_time=4)
except Exception:
done = False
error_dialog(None, _('Failed to repair library'), _(
'Could not repair library. Click "Show details" for more information.'), det_msg=traceback.format_exc(), show=True)
if done:
subprocess.Popen([sys.executable])
app.quit()
